1.16.22 - Sculpt progress on Star Wars: Dark Times (Dark Horse Comics) Dass Jennir and Falco Sang along with my first sculpt update on the "OG" bounty hunter, Skorr from the classic Marvel comic strip The Bounty Hunter of Ord Mantell. All 1:18 scale.
Holidays are over, the decorations are stored, time to get back to work.
Sculpt progress on Dass Jennir. I finished the first set of variant forearms that are connected by the magnets seen in my last update. Strong attachments, as if they were jointed. The second variant will have the forearms wrapped as they appeared when Jennir rode his steed. I also worked on building up the chest sculpt a bit, adding a loosely fitted collar to the shirt. Added some more hair to the head sculpt and began working on a hood/head combo that will work independently from one another rather than being a single, static sculpt.
Also worked on Jenir's steed. The sculpt as seen here in the photos will need a complete rework with the exception of the head and horns. The entire body needs to be thinned out, the neck especially. The neck also needs to be elongated and the center articulation cut removed. I never liked that and it serves no purpose. I think the body is ok...just too thick, muscular. Nothing wrong with some definition but right now the body is looking too much like a Clydesdale.
Falco Sang progress. Started sculpting the upper body and arms of the figure. I'm not sure if the character's "sneaking suit" contained a texture? In the comics, it's a flat black. I took a little artistic license and added a subtle texture to the bodysuit. When painted, I think it will make the figure much more interesting to look at. Also sculpted one of the shoulder guards. Not sure how it will connect to the figure at this point. I'm looking at some clear or black elastic mini bands to go over the shoulder. I want a free range of movement, that's for certain. Finally, I worked a bit more on Falco's unmasked head sculpt. Sanding down the scalp and sculpting ears. I plan on sculpting his hair this week. I also need to begin working on his doid, Ize.
The true "OG" bounty hunter. Before Boba, there was Skorr - the Bounty Hunter of Ord Mantell. You've seen the head sculpt before - I sculpted that back in 2011 I think? It needs a little work to bring it up to the standards I have now. Back then I was having issues learning to blend layers of epoxy at this scale. If you zoom in on this sculpt, you will see where layers ended and new layers began. Some simple sanding and resculpting will bring the head to sculpt up to date so expect a better look coming soon. The body is a dremeled down Spartan figure from Boss Fight. Nothing modded yet. I'm sure I will replace the neck joint and add more articulation but this will be the frame of choice. Gathered all the source images I could find so I hope to begin having better updates for you all in the immediate future.
Bonus! I'll be sculpting his sidekick "Gribbet" who is a Rybet bounty hunter and whose species ironically appears in the Dark Horse series! I've included a panel image showing the creature standing near Dass Jennir.

11_15 Sculpt update on Dass Jennir v2.0 (Star Wars: Dark Times)...
Some have confused this figure as a redo of my orginal Dass?...Not so. This is a second version of the character featured in the "Out of the Wilderness" arc.
starwars.fandom.com/wiki/Star_Wars:_Dark_Times—Out_of_t...
Similar clothing, not as heavy. This figure will be more articulated than the orignal so it can be placed on horseback. That or I will sculpt a modified, static lower half that will sit in the saddle.
You see here just how much sculpt needs to go into the awkward looking skeletal framework. I've started on the boots and the left shoulder. Also adjustments to the head sculpts...the beard will be reduced and the hair sculpted over again. The helmet needs to fit lower on the head than seen.
I kept the image grayscale because I'm looking at the build, not the paint scheme at this point.

12.30.21 Sculpt update - Dass Jennir and Falco Sang - Star Wars: Dark Times (Dark Horse Comics). 1:18 scale.
Hey guys! Finally received magnets needed for my forearm variants to Jennir. The character is featured in the comic with and without arm wraps, so I'll be creating variant sculpts for each. Having those minor variants will allow me to make the figure more versatile in its appearance. They are glued directly to the plastic frame and will be sculpted over. The magnets are strong enough to have a firm hold to one another but not enough to interfere with the opposite arm or waist magnet. The only downside with using magnets in the interaction with other figures using the same methodology. Forces seem to attract or repel one another when in close range LOL! Small price to pay...
Added some sculpt to the chest. More will be added I'm sure. I also want to reduce the lower abdomen again.
Also working on the maskless head sculpt to Falco Sang. Making some changes to an older cast I had that strikes a resemblance to the character. Reworking the upper body sculpt as well.

11.23 Sculpt update on Jedi Dass Jennir - Dark Times "Out of the Wilderness" arc - Dark Horse Comics. 1:18 scale.
So the feeble frame is beginning to grow some meat on its bones. Great to be working on Star Wars related customs again...some old reflexes coming back.
It's been awhile since I've built some frames to sculpt over. So far, so good! To this point I've built up the feet, both upper legs, left shoulder, lower and upper abdomen. All the articulation remains although it was a challenge to guess the cut through the sculpt of the upper thigh but I got close enough.
Adjustments will be made as I go along. Just need my xacto, dremel and sandpaper at my side. The upper leg sculpt may be reduced off the knee joint for better clearance. I've already made adjustments to the lower abdomen/crotch.
Working on the head sculpt as well. The "Out of the Wilderness" arc has Dass sporting a shorter haricut along with more manageable facial hair. I'm also adding better defined ears becasue several years back, I wasn't all that great at sculpting them! LOL! This version of Dass will have a number of differences to that of it's predecessor. You'll see that come to light as the figure develops.

7.5.22 Sculpt update on Falco Sang - Bouthy Hunter/Assassin from the Dark Horse comic series Star Wars: Dark Times.
Been several weeks since I made any progress on this figure. This update centers on the alternate head sculpt.
After looking over the character studies Doug Wheatley did for the story arc, I made a small change to the bridge of the character's nose by adding a dorsal hump to the bridge. I also added the hair and recently detailed the ears more as the initial sculpts looked too simplified and a little large in proportion.
I'm only going to update with the more recent images taken but you can find more of my progression when I upload all the images over the past several weeks on my FLICKR photostream soon...I'll post a link once updated.
Working on some better articulation to the waist and will sculpt the lower legs and feet soon.
